Output 3b6128cce706cba092340f33994a4665309d9b7a8f42db01ba994e6564eba0d1:0

value
612283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d31a5130227ea21c41fd1d1d6fe7c2aa4cf532 OP_EQUAL
address
3JuRrHduo5sxVZNSHekLtNwSgCroh4Eys2
transaction
3b6128cce706cba092340f33994a4665309d9b7a8f42db01ba994e6564eba0d1
spent
true